And then there’s the sheer variety of roulette variants. You’ll find European, French, and American wheels, each with its own set of quirks. The French wheel’s “la partage” rule is a mercy you’ll rarely see in the wild, as operators love to lock you into the worst‑case scenario.

Key factors to audit before you place that first chip

  • Licensing: A UKGC licence is non‑negotiable. Anything else is a gamble in itself.
  • Banking speed: If withdrawals take longer than a season of a soap opera, walk away.
  • Customer support: Real humans, not chat‑bots that repeat the same canned apology.
  • Game fairness: Look for audited RNGs, not “provably fair” nonsense that only works on blockchain sites.
  • Bonus transparency: No “free” money without a hidden clause. “Gift” offers usually come with a 60x rollover.

Because the house always wins, the only rational strategy is to minimise the house edge, not chase the illusion of a big win. That means picking a European wheel, avoiding the American double zero, and steering clear of tables that inflate the minimum bet just to squeeze you for more cash.
